Output fde95e343547feb3c386dfad6c39e61e9722efbdf089bb18d28d1c8e1ceedaa0:0

value
156330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2866073bbef625c6fbd9923c1ed3d07bf99881 OP_EQUAL
address
3EHXZxSUr2JjNKtwLriouaBMnzcUkmJrjg
transaction
fde95e343547feb3c386dfad6c39e61e9722efbdf089bb18d28d1c8e1ceedaa0